"You Are Not Ivan Gallatin" is a psychological thriller that begins with the protagonist receiving a series of mysterious presents. What starts as an innocent and intriguing gift-giving soon escalates into a nightmare, all revolving around the unsettling premise that the recipient is "not Ivan Gallatin." This twist triggers a suspenseful exploration of identity, perception, and the consequences of mistaken identity.
